As indicated by the above photos, today was an incredible MK day - I haven’t seen MK with these crowds in a long time. Waits for most rides were in the 5-30 minute range for the whole morning - we were able to accomplish so much in such a short period. And the weather was perfect - beautiful, crisp in the morning and warm and lovely throughout the day. And the decorations. Seeing Main Street at Christmas is something special. I can’t wait until we come back Saturday evening to see everything lit up.




In the afterboon we took the monorail to go to the Contemporary and Grand Floridian to see the gingerbread houses.

It was another full day today. Morning at Hollywood Studios where we hit all the highlights - busier crowds than at MK yesterday but still not bad. DHS does look great during the holiday season.






The weather was absolutely beautiful today with highs in the low 80s - so we decided on a midday swim, which was a nice break. We then spent the evening at Disney Springs and rounded out the day there, which is also quite beautifully decorated.

Saturday - our last day at Disney ( :cry:) began with a character breakfast at Cape May Cafe. We had eaten there in June and everyone enjoyed it then, and this time we didn’t tell the boys beforehand that the characters would be there.

After breakfast, we walked to Epcot. We toured the countries, hit a few of the attractions we hadn’t yet, including Living with the Land, Christmas edition. It was fun to see, even though it was daylight and the lighting didn’t have the same impact as I’m sure it does at night.

One observation about Epcot (not related to today) - out of the three parks we visited plus Disney Springs, we found it the most underwhelming from a decorations perspective. Epcot being our favorite park, we were hoping for more. I am wondering if they’re holding off until the construction is done to really beef it up.

That aside, I always love Epcot and we had a lot of fun there.





We then went back to the hotel to do some initial packing and organizing, then headed to MK for our last evening. We wandered, hit a few rides, and then just took in the ambiance on Main Street, enjoying slthr castle projections and seeing Main Street all decked out before returning to our hotel to finish packing. It was a fun, family MK evening and the perfect end to our trip.
